Our Mission and Founding Purpose
In response to Japan’s prolonged economic stagnation, an increasing number of mothers have sought employment while raising children — leading to a sharp rise in the number of children on waiting lists for childcare. While local governments and the national government have taken steps to address this issue, including relaxing facility requirements under the Child Welfare Act, concerns have emerged about the potential decline in childcare quality, especially with the rise of unregulated daycare centers operating in inadequate environments.
Moved by these challenges, we founded the Specified Nonprofit Corporation “Hoikusapōto” Center to support the well-being of children by offering individual consultations, workplace-based training, and practical assistance for both parents and childcare workers. As an NPO, our mission is to ensure that families — especially those with limited resources — and childcare professionals can access trustworthy, affordable support.
Our board is composed of individuals with diverse backgrounds, including experienced nursery teachers, early childhood educators, journalists, and parents with lived experiences raising children with disabilities or navigating divorce. United by compassion and a shared sense of responsibility, we aim to create a society where children can thrive and every caregiver receives the support they need.
